The Jonas Brothers have had two whole careers: the Disney Channel years of Camp Rock, JONAS and squeaky-clean teen idols, and the grown-up comeback that opened with a number one debut in 2019. This quiz covers both in 80 questions, from a childhood in Bergen County, New Jersey and a Columbia debut that barely got released, to Hollywood Records, the 3D concert film, the 2013 split and the reunion that produced Happiness Begins, The Album and Greetings from Your Hometown. You will also be asked about the solo years (Nick's chart hits and The Voice, Joe's DNCE, Kevin's reality TV and construction firm), the wives who starred in the Sucker video, a reluctant nickname for Frankie, Grammy nominations, a Razzie, a Walk of Fame star and a CFL halftime show. Q 01Which of the three band members is the oldest?
Kevin
Kevin was born in November 1987, Joe in August 1989 and Nick in September 1992, with youngest brother Frankie arriving in 2000.
Q 02The brothers grew up in which New Jersey town?
Wyckoff
Kevin was born in nearby Teaneck, but the family home was in Wyckoff in Bergen County; the band moved to Little Falls in 2005 to write their first record.
Q 03Nick, the only brother not born in New Jersey, was born in which state?
Texas
He was born in Dallas in 1992; the family later bought a house in Southlake, Texas, where Frankie spent much of his teens.
Q 04Nick was discovered at the age of six in what kind of place, while his mother was getting her hair cut?
A barber shop
The referral led to a show-business manager and, by age seven, roles on Broadway.
Q 05Nick wrote his first single, 'Joy to the World', while appearing in which Broadway musical?
Beauty and the Beast
He played Chip Potts in the show; the song came out on a Broadway charity carols album before Christian radio picked it up in 2003.
Q 06Nick was diagnosed with type 1 diabetes in 2005 at what age?
13
He manages the condition with an insulin pump and has testified before the US Senate for more research funding.
Q 07Which Columbia Records president heard "Please Be Mine" and signed the three brothers as a group?
Steve Greenberg
Greenberg disliked Nick's solo album but loved his voice, and ended up co-producing the band's debut record.
Q 08What alternative band name did the three brothers consider before choosing the one they kept?
Sons of Jonas
The rejected name would have fit their upbringing: their father was an ordained minister.
Q 09What was the title of the band's 2006 debut album?
It's About Time
Delayed several times by executive changes at Sony, it finally arrived on August 8, 2006, on Columbia's Daylight imprint.
Q 10What was the band's first single, released in December 2005?
Mandy
Its three-part music video reached number four on MTV's Total Request Live in February 2006.
Q 11"Year 3000" and "What I Go to School For" on the debut album were covers of songs by which British band?
Busted
The favour was returned in 2019, when the brothers performed the song with the original band at Capital's Summertime Ball, and again on 2023's "Year 3000 2.0".
Q 12According to the band's manager, the debut album was a limited release of roughly how many copies?
50,000
That scarcity is why sealed copies were later fetching a couple of hundred dollars on eBay; Columbia dropped the band in early 2007.

Q 21In July 2008 the brothers became the youngest band ever to appear on the cover of which magazine?
Rolling Stone
The same magazine later ranked their third album number 40 on its best albums of 2008 list.
Q 22At the 51st Grammy Awards, the Jonas Brothers were nominated in which category?
Best New Artist
They lost to Adele, but that same season they picked up Breakthrough Artist at the American Music Awards.
Q 23The opening act on the band's 2009 world tour was a girl group from which country?
South Korea
Wonder Girls used the tour to make their American debut, a decade before K-pop became a fixture on US charts.

Q 14The brothers made their acting debut in August 2007 on which Disney Channel series?
Hannah Montana
The episode, titled "Me and Mr. Jonas and Mr. Jonas and Mr. Jonas", drew 10.7 million viewers and became basic cable's most-watched series telecast ever.
Q 15In Camp Rock, the brothers played a pop trio with what name?
Connect 3
The 2008 film was the 73rd Disney Channel Original Movie and pulled 8.9 million viewers on premiere night.
Q 16Which character did Joe play in Camp Rock?
Shane Gray
Joe had the lead male role as the spoiled frontman sent to camp to fix his image; his brothers played Nate and Jason.
Q 17Camp Rock was shot at real summer camps in which Canadian province?
Ontario
Filming took place at YMCA Camp Wanakita in Haliburton and Kilcoo Camp in Minden during autumn 2007, and the sequel returned to Ontario in 2009.
Q 18Who performs the uncredited rap on "Burnin' Up"?
The band's bodyguard
Robert "Big Rob" Feggans also joined them on stage for the song in their 3D concert film.
Q 19In the "Burnin' Up" music video, Nick imagines himself as which fictional spy?
James Bond
Joe plays a Sonny Crockett-style detective and Kevin a kung fu master, with cameos from Selena Gomez, David Carradine, Robert Davi and Danny Trejo.
Q 20Nick wrote the title track of the band's 2008 album about what?
Living with his diabetes
The record itself was the group's first to debut at number one, selling 525,402 copies in its first week.
Q 24What did the brothers voice in Night at the Museum: Battle of the Smithsonian?
Stone cherubs
"Fly with Me" from their fourth album also played over the film's end credits in May 2009.
Q 25The original concept for the Disney series JONAS had the brothers secretly working as what?
Government spies
The working title J.O.N.A.S. stood for Junior Operatives Networking as Spies; the writers' strike and the band's growing fame led to a grounded reboot instead.
Q 26For its second season, the brothers' Disney sitcom was retitled to reflect a move to which city?
Los Angeles
Retitled Jonas L.A., it was the first Disney Channel sitcom to move its main setting mid-run, following the brothers to a summer house.
Q 27Which song served as the theme for the JONAS TV series?
Live to Party
It debuted as a new studio recording in their 3D concert film before the show premiered.
Q 28Jonas Brothers: The 3D Concert Experience won the brothers which Golden Raspberry Award?
Worst Actor
They were also nominated for Worst Screen Couple as "any two (or more) Jonas Brothers"; the film still grossed $30.4 million worldwide.
Q 29At a 2010 White House concert, the brothers covered 'Drive My Car' for which honoree?
Paul McCartney
The event marked his Gershwin Prize for Popular Song from President Obama; the brothers had first played the White House at the 2007 Easter Egg Roll.
Q 30Kevin met his future wife Danielle while their families were on holiday where in May 2007?
The Bahamas
They married at Oheka Castle on Long Island in December 2009 with Joe and Nick as best men.
